> I want to tap my 'switched power' into something that gets power when key is
> IN the ignition, but not neccessarily ON. Best source of that would be the
> door chime relay. So, I am trying to find the wire that goes from the
> ignition to the door chime relay thing in the aux relay panel.
Yes, I tend to call it the seatbelt warning relay. Why not yank the
dumb chime and just plug a spade into the right socket? I ran my "start
to stop" for my express windows modules from "key in" to "door open"
using two terminals from that socket.
If you like the chime, build a little breakout box for it (old relay
base, 1/2 to 1" wires, relay socket) and tap into the appropriate
lines. Or...
